  1. Understanding SCH40 PVC Fittings: SCH40 PVC fittings are components made from Schedule 40 Polyvinyl Chloride (PVC) piping. The term "schedule" refers to the thickness of the walls of the PVC pipe, with SCH40 being a common choice for general-purpose applications. These fittings are available in a wide range of shapes, sizes, and configurations, allowing for flexible installation in various plumbing systems.
  2. Benefits of SCH40 PVC Fittings: Before we dive into their specific uses, let's examine the key advantages of SCH40 PVC fittings:

2.1. Durability and Longevity: SCH40 PVC fittings are highly resistant to corrosion, chemicals, and weathering. They can withstand harsh environments, making them ideal for both indoor and outdoor applications. These fittings have a long lifespan, reducing maintenance and replacement costs over time.

2.2. Cost-Effective Solution: Compared to alternative materials, such as metal fittings, SCH40 PVC fittings are more cost-effective. They are relatively inexpensive, readily available, and easy to install, allowing for significant savings in material and labor costs.

2.3. Lightweight and Easy to Handle: SCH40 PVC fittings are lightweight, making them easy to transport and handle during installation. This characteristic simplifies the construction process and reduces the need for heavy machinery or additional manpower.

2.4. Excellent Chemical Resistance: One of the standout features of SCH40 PVC fittings is their resistance to various chemicals and corrosive substances. This makes them suitable for applications involving acids, alkalis, and other harsh chemicals, making them highly versatile in industrial settings.

  1. Common Applications of SCH40 PVC Fittings: Let's now explore some of the most common uses for SCH40 PVC fittings:

3.1. Plumbing Systems: SCH40 PVC fittings find extensive use in plumbing systems, both in residential and commercial buildings. They are used for connecting pipes, redirecting flow, and controlling fluid direction. From drainage and waste systems to potable water supply lines, these fittings offer reliable and leak-resistant connections.

3.2. Irrigation and Agriculture: The durability and chemical resistance of SCH40 PVC fittings make them ideal for agricultural applications. They are commonly used in irrigation systems, water supply networks, and greenhouse plumbing. The fittings' resistance to corrosion ensures longevity, even when exposed to moisture and various fertilizers.

3.3. Pool and Spa Installations: SCH40 PVC fittings are widely used in the construction and maintenance of swimming pools, hot tubs, and spa installations. These fittings can withstand the chemicals used in water treatment, making them an excellent choice for plumbing and filtration systems within these recreational facilities.

3.4. Industrial Applications: Given their excellent chemical resistance and durability, SCH40 PVC fittings are extensively utilized in industrial settings. They are commonly found in chemical processing plants, factories, and laboratories where corrosive fluids and chemicals are handled. These fittings offer reliable connections, ensuring the integrity of the plumbing systems.

3.5. HVAC Systems: SCH40 PVC fittings are suitable for use in heating, ventilation, and air conditioning (HVAC) systems. They can be employed in ductwork, condensate drains, and ventilation systems due to their resistance to temperature fluctuations and moisture.

  1. Installation Considerations: When working with SCH40 PVC fittings, several factors should be considered:

4.1. Proper Sizing and Configuration: Selecting the appropriate size and type of SCH40 PVC fittings is crucial for a successful installation. Take into account the dimensions and requirements of your specific project to ensure a proper fit.

4.2. Adhesive and Sealant: To achieve leak-free connections, SCH40 PVC fittings require the use of PVC cement or adhesive and a suitable sealant. Follow the manufacturer's instructions to ensure proper bonding and sealing.

4.3. Temperature Considerations: While SCH40 PVC fittings can withstand a broad temperature range, it is essential to consider the specific temperature requirements of your project. Consult the manufacturer's specifications to ensure the fittings are compatible with the intended application.

Most Common Sizes and Applications

The most common sizes of SCH40 PVC fittings can vary depending on the specific application and region. Here are some of the most commonly used SCH40 PVC fitting sizes and their typical applications:

  1. 1/2 inch:
  • Used for small-scale plumbing projects, such as residential water supply lines, irrigation systems, and low-flow applications.
  1. 3/4 inch:
  • Commonly used in residential plumbing systems for water supply lines, sprinkler systems, and outdoor irrigation.
  1. 1 inch:
  • Suitable for a wide range of applications, including residential and commercial plumbing, irrigation systems, and pool/spa installations.
  1. 1 1/4 inches:
  • Often used for larger residential plumbing projects, underground water lines, and sprinkler systems in medium-sized yards.
  1. 1 1/2 inches:
  • Commonly found in residential plumbing, sewage systems, drainage systems, and sprinkler installations.
  1. 2 inches:
  • Frequently used in commercial plumbing, industrial applications, larger irrigation systems, and underground water mains.
  1. 3 inches:
  • Suitable for larger-scale plumbing projects, including commercial buildings, industrial applications, and underground drainage systems.
  1. 4 inches:
  • Primarily used in industrial applications, municipal water supply systems, large-scale irrigation, and wastewater management.
  1. 6 inches and above:
  • These larger sizes are typically utilized in industrial settings, municipal projects, and specialized applications requiring high flow rates or handling large volumes of water or chemicals.

It's important to consult local building codes and regulations, as well as specific project requirements, to determine the appropriate SCH40 PVC fitting sizes needed for your application.
